1.15 takayama 3: The OpenXM package is a package of mathematical software systems.
4: The OpenXM protocol provides an infrastructure for free, or open source
5: mathematical software systems.

1.18 takayama 19: -------- An instruction for a quick installation from the source code ---
1.16 takayama 20: (cd OpenXM/src ; make configure ; make install)
21: You will get binaries, libraries, and documents under
22: OpenXM/bin, OpenXM/lib, OpenXM/doc
1.17 takayama 23: (cd OpenXM/rc ; make install)
1.16 takayama 24: Shell scripts to start "asir", "sm1", ... will be copied to
25: /usr/local/bin
26:
1.17 takayama 27: ------- If you need only asir and kan,
1.16 takayama 28: (cd OpenXM/src ; make install-kan-ox ; make install-asir-contrib)
29: You will get only asir (OpenXM version) and kan/sm1.
1.17 takayama 30: (cd OpenXM/rc ; make install)

33: Risa/Asir with asir-contrib is the main client system in the OpenXM project.
34: You can start Risa/Asir by the command "asir".
35: The manual of Risa/Asir and Asir-contrib can be found in the
36: OpenXM/doc directory and http://www.openxm.org
